Are the sectors: Real Estate & Construction ready for the challenges ahead?
There is definitely no shortage of them:
- Current situation in the area of General Contracting
- Economic and legislative uncertainty
- Increased customer awareness and changing tenant preferences
- Progressive innovation and digitization vs. implementation realities and practice
- ESG and sustainable construction trends

Photo: Greenfields
Today's closed event of the Real Estate & Construction working group, in collaboration with @Brytyjsko-Polską Izbą Gospodarczą, organized by @Kochański i Partnerzy, was a summary of the 2024 key aspects, as well as trends and outlook for the upcoming year.
Roundtable with representatives of Property Industry was an excellent platform for exchanging opinions about current situation and future of market.
